I have a 2020 MacBook Pro with Intel processor, 2 ThunderBolt-3 ports, running Catalina. Can I use a Thunderbolt 3 to Thunderbolt 2 adapter to connect to an iMac 2013 running High Sierra?
I have a 2020 MacBook Pro with Intel processor, 2 ThunderBolt-3 ports, running Catalina. Can I use a Thunderbolt 3 to Thunderbolt 2 adapter to connect to an iMac 2013 running High Sierra?
No. The source computer must be a 2019 model or earlier to support Target Display mode.
